Output db40a91baf80bb1e448dbdea53e6224e95d4e0d93065a7c7d3efa42f837b45ea:0

value
14901368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7efbfad4031e8ce5333fa814011a47bb37e494c9 OP_EQUAL
address
3DGSvaTUrjEnLDfZh9Mb2XYXj3V1aYCg3q
transaction
db40a91baf80bb1e448dbdea53e6224e95d4e0d93065a7c7d3efa42f837b45ea
spent
true